CHC Navigation Announces Major Updates to i93, i85, i76 and iBase GNSS Receivers

SHANGHAI, April 01, 2026 (GLOBE NEWSWIRE) -- CHC Navigation (CHCNAV), a global provider of surveying, mapping, and positioning GNSS technology, announced major updates to its i93, i85, and i76 GNSS receivers, as well as the iBase professional base station. The updates are designed to further improve positioning stability, simplify field setup, and expand operational capability across demanding surveying environments.
